    Tony, Welcome from Glamorless Glendale.
    One thing to keep in mind if you chop the exhaust is the emissions check. They require the exhaust to come out from under the vehicle.
    Now if you save the cut off piece and get a clamp to put it on for testing it might get you passed.

    Had this problem on a Camaro my kid had and we had to run extensions out.

    Good luck on your mods!
